Title: | MORTARIUM | |
Category Code: | C | |
Year: | 1937 | |
Object Number: | 313 | |
Description: | Flat bottom, strongly concave wall, heavy rounded rim. Handles have three well-preserved beades. The beginning of the spout remains. No wheel marks. | |
Decoration: | Self-slipped top of bowl and over the rim. | |
Material: | Large to medium red to gray inclusions and red grit. | |
Munsell Color: | Core 2.5YR 8-7/4-6 | |
Condition: | Complete profile. Fourteen joining fragments preserve full profile. | |
Chronology: | Early fourth century. | |
Bibliography: | Corinth VII.3, p. 110, no. 623; Villing & Pemberton 2010, Hesperia 79.4, cat. 37 | |
